Popular State Parks Near Onawa, IA

Located in Iowa on the eastern bank of the Missouri River, Lewis and Clark State Park offers a scenic and serene natural setting for outdoor enthusiasts. The park provides 121 RV campsites equipped with electrical hookups, ensuring a comfortable stay for campers. Amenities such as restrooms, showers, picnic tables, and fire pits are available. Situated in the northwest corner of Iowa near Sioux City, Stone State Park is known for its stunning natural beauty with deep canyons, towering bluffs, and picturesque woodland areas. The park offers a campground with RV sites equipped with electrical hookups along with amenities like restrooms, showers, and a playground. Hiking trails allow visitors to explore the diverse landscape and observe wildlife such as deer, turkey, foxes, and various bird species. Ponca State Park in Nebraska offers RV enthusiasts a scenic destination on the banks of the Missouri River. Fishing and boating opportunities are abundant in this area. The park provides various camping options including RV sites with electrical hookups. The park also offers deer and turkey hunting opportunities, winter activities like cross-country skiing and snowshoeing, and a modern swimming pool and water play area. Located in Shelby County, Iowa, Prairie Rose State Park offers a variety of camping options including RV sites with electrical hookups as well as non-modern sites. Recreational activities include picnicking, swimming at the beach, fishing in the lake, and hiking on scenic trails.

RVshare’s Top Picks for Nearby RV Parks & Campgrounds

On-Ur-Wa RV Park RV campground in Onawa, Iowa offers 25 RV sites with full hookups for 30/50 Amp. Both back-in and pull-through sites are available. Showers are provided, and pets are allowed. You'll have cell reception here, as well as Wi-Fi access. Located in Onawa, Blue Lake KOA RV park has 44 sites with full hookups for 30/50 Amp. You can choose between back-in and pull-through sites. Showers are available, and pets are welcome. Cell reception is good here.Lewis and Clark State Park is Situated near Onawa, this park offers showers and allows pets. You'll have cell reception here as well.Snyder Bend Park near Onawa provides showers and allows pets. You can expect good cell reception here too.

RV Dump Stations Near Onawa, IA

Dump stations near Onawa, Iowa include the Rest Area - Onawa, Southbound and Pisgah City Park.Travelers can also find convenient dump stations at Bob Hardy RV Park and Rest Stop I-80 EB Underwood.These dump stations provide facilities for dumping black water and gray water, as well as fresh water for flushing tanks. Additionally, there are RV trash bins available for waste disposal at these locations.

Frequently Asked Questions About Renting a Class C RV Near Onawa, IA

How do I properly navigate and park a Class C motorhome rental in urban areas or tight spaces in Onawa, IA?

When navigating and parking a Class C motorhome rental in urban areas or tight spaces, it's important to take your time and plan your route beforehand. Familiarize yourself with the dimensions of the motorhome and the height and width restrictions of the roads you'll be traveling on. When it comes to parking, look for designated spots or parking garages that can accommodate the size of your RV. Always pay attention to signage and be aware of any towing restrictions in the area.

Do I need to know any weight or height restrictions when driving a Class C motorhome rental in Onawa, IA?

Yes, it's important to be aware of weight and height restrictions when driving a Class C motorhome rental in Onawa, IA. Many bridges and overpasses have low clearance levels that may not accommodate the height of your RV. Additionally, be mindful of the weight of your vehicle and ensure that you're not exceeding any weight limits on the roads you're traveling.

What fuel efficiency considerations do I need to consider when driving a Class C motorhome rental, and how can I minimize the impact on my fuel costs?

Class C motorhome rentals are generally less fuel-efficient than smaller vehicles, so it's important to be mindful of your fuel usage. To minimize fuel costs, try to stick to slower speeds and avoid idling or rapid acceleration. Planning out your route ahead of time can also help you save fuel by avoiding unnecessary detours or backtracking.
